5. Pick a book you learned a lot from.


I'm going to throw Salt to the Sea by Ruta Sepetys out there again. I learned a lot about WWII history reading this book! I couldn't believe I'd never heard of the disaster that is the sinking of the Wilhelm Gustloff before reading this book! And there are several other things that I'd never heard of in this book, like the massacre at Nemmersdorf! So if you're in the mood for a history lesson, read this book! Report back.
